从AI工具到智能决策者:三种AI应用架构的深度解析与实践指南

一、AI应用架构演进的技术驱动力

在金融风控、智能制造、智慧医疗等场景中,AI已从辅助工具进化为业务系统的核心决策引擎。这种演进背后是三大技术趋势的叠加:

  1. 模型能力跃迁:从文本理解到多模态推理,从单轮响应到长上下文记忆,基础模型的能力边界持续突破
  2. 工程化需求升级:企业需要构建可观测、可追溯、可干预的AI系统,而非简单的”黑箱”调用
  3. 业务场景复杂化:从离线分析到实时决策,从单一任务到跨系统协同,应用场景呈现指数级复杂度增长

这种变革催生出三种典型架构模式,每种模式对应不同的技术成熟度曲线和ROI模型。

二、模式一:AI调用——原子化服务的标准化封装

技术特征

作为最基础的AI应用形态,AI调用呈现三大特征:

  • 无状态设计:每次请求独立处理,通过会话ID实现有限上下文关联
  • 低延迟要求:典型场景如实时翻译、图像识别需在200ms内返回结果
  • 标准化接口:采用RESTful或gRPC协议,支持JSON/Protobuf数据格式

典型场景

  1. # 示例:调用文本分类API的Python代码
  2. import requests
  3. def classify_text(api_key, text):
  4. url = "https://api.example.com/v1/classify"
  5. headers = {"Authorization": f"Bearer {api_key}"}
  6. payload = {"text": text, "model": "general_v3"}
  7. response = requests.post(url, headers=headers, json=payload)
  8. return response.json()["classification"]
  9. print(classify_text("YOUR_API_KEY", "这段文字需要分类"))

在智能客服场景中,该模式可实现85%的常见问题自动解答,但无法处理多轮对话中的指代消解问题。

架构要点

  1. 提示工程优化

    • 采用Few-shot学习减少标注数据依赖
    • 通过Chain-of-Thought引导模型逐步推理
    • 示例:将”解释代码”请求转化为”作为资深开发者,请分步骤解释以下代码的功能”
  2. 服务治理设计

    • 熔断机制:当模型响应时间超过阈值时自动降级
    • 流量染色:区分测试流量与生产流量
    • 版本控制:支持A/B测试与灰度发布
  3. 成本优化策略

    • 缓存机制:对高频请求结果进行本地缓存
    • 批量处理:合并多个小请求为单个批量调用
    • 模型蒸馏:用小模型替代大模型处理简单任务

三、模式二:AI工作流——业务流程的智能化重构

技术特征

当AI需要参与复杂业务流程时,工作流架构成为必然选择:

  • 状态管理:通过工作流引擎维护任务上下文
  • 系统集成:与数据库、消息队列等组件深度交互
  • 异常处理:定义重试机制、回滚策略和人工干预节点

典型场景

在保险理赔流程中,AI工作流可实现:

  1. 自动提取理赔单中的关键信息
  2. 调用反欺诈模型进行风险评估
  3. 根据评估结果触发不同审批路径
  4. 实时更新流程状态至业务系统

架构设计

  1. graph TD
  2. A[用户提交理赔单] --> B[OCR识别]
  3. B --> C{金额>阈值?}
  4. C -->|是| D[人工复核]
  5. C -->|否| E[自动审批]
  6. D --> F[生成审批报告]
  7. E --> F
  8. F --> G[更新核心系统]

关键组件包括:

  1. 工作流引擎:支持BPMN 2.0标准的开源引擎如Camunda
  2. 状态存储:采用Redis或时序数据库记录流程实例状态
  3. 事件驱动:通过消息队列实现组件间解耦
  4. 监控系统:集成Prometheus实现全链路追踪

实施挑战

  • 长事务处理:需设计补偿机制应对部分节点失败
  • 版本兼容性:流程升级时需支持新旧版本并行运行
  • 性能瓶颈:异步处理与同步等待的平衡设计

四、模式三:AI智能体——自主决策系统的构建范式

技术特征

智能体架构代表AI应用的最高形态,具有三大核心能力:

  • 环境感知:通过多模态输入理解复杂场景
  • 自主决策:基于强化学习或规划算法选择最优行动
  • 持续学习:在线更新模型参数适应环境变化

典型场景

在自动驾驶系统中,智能体需要:

  1. 实时处理摄像头、雷达等多源数据
  2. 在0.1秒内做出变道、刹车等决策
  3. 根据路况变化动态调整驾驶策略
  4. 通过影子模式持续收集训练数据

架构解构

  1. class AutonomousAgent:
  2. def __init__(self):
  3. self.perception = PerceptionModule()
  4. self.planner = PlanningModule()
  5. self.actuator = ActuatorInterface()
  6. self.memory = EpisodicMemory()
  7. def step(self, observation):
  8. # 环境感知
  9. state = self.perception.process(observation)
  10. # 决策规划
  11. action = self.planner.decide(state, self.memory)
  12. # 执行反馈
  13. self.actuator.execute(action)
  14. # 记忆更新
  15. self.memory.update(state, action)

关键技术组件:

  1. 决策引擎:集成PPO、SAC等强化学习算法
  2. 知识图谱:构建领域本体支持推理决策
  3. 仿真环境:通过数字孪生技术进行安全测试
  4. 安全机制:设计冗余系统和应急停止逻辑

五、架构选型决策框架

选择合适架构需综合评估四大维度:

评估维度 AI调用 AI工作流 AI智能体
业务复杂度
实时性要求 极高
开发周期
维护成本

建议采用渐进式演进路线:

  1. 初期:通过AI调用快速验证业务价值
  2. 成长期:用工作流整合现有系统
  3. 成熟期:构建智能体实现自主优化

六、未来趋势展望

随着大模型技术的突破,AI应用架构将呈现三大趋势:

  1. 低代码化:通过可视化编排工具降低开发门槛
  2. 自适应架构:系统自动检测性能瓶颈并优化拓扑
  3. 边缘智能:在设备端实现轻量化智能体部署

技术决策者需建立动态评估机制,定期审视架构是否匹配业务发展需求。在某金融客户的实践中,通过从AI调用升级到工作流架构,将信贷审批周期从3天缩短至4小时,同时将人工干预率降低67%。这种架构演进带来的价值提升,正是AI技术商业化的核心路径。